Abstract
Metals and oxygen are chemically linked in biological systems. Metals and oxygen play important roles in enzymatic reactions, metabolism, an d signal transduction; however, metals and oxygen react to form highly toxic oxygen-derived free radical species. In this review we focus on the use of yeast cells, as unicellular eukaryotic model systems, to c onduct studies aimed at understanding fundamental mechanisms for the s ensation and protective responses to toxic metals and oxygen-derived r adicals via the activation of yeast metallothionein gene expression.
